Manchester United are turning to Napoli for Elseid Hysaj, claim Sky Sport Italia, as he’d cost less than half what Crystal Palace are asking for Aaron Wan-Bissaka.
Their interest in Wan-Bissaka is well-known, but Palace have rejected multiple offers for the England Under-21 international and are believed to be holding out for £60m (around €67.5m).
The most recent proposal is believed to be worth £40m (€45m), including various add-ons.
With that in mind, Sky Sport Italia transfer expert Gianluca Di Marzio claims Manchester United have turned their attention towards a far more affordable full-back.
Napoli have put Hysaj on the market with interest from Atletico Madrid and Juventus, but so far nobody has reached the €25m (£22.2m) asking price.
That is less than half what Crystal Palace are asking for Wan-Bissaka and would be relatively easy to get the deal sorted out quickly.
